Dhyane Dhyanen Radhaya Vyayante Dhyanatatparah.
Ihaiv Jivanmuktaste Paratr Krishnaparshadah.
- Brahmavaivartapuran - 4.124.97 (Section 4 [ Shrikrishnajanmakhandah]/ Chapter 124 / Verse 97)
Those who remain constantly absorbed in the contemplation of Śrī Rādhā and fix their minds exclusively upon Her become liberated even while living in this very life. After leaving their bodies, they attain the eternal service of Śrī Kṛṣṇa as His divine associates.
